Title: Motion Design Intern
Role Overview
You will play a crucial role in providing support to the Creative team and bring a deep understanding of how screen-based content can interact with physical objects in novel and beautiful ways.
Job Responsibilities
- Concepting and Ideation - Bring a digital point of view and eye to early-phase concepts.
- Art Direction - Ability to bring brand character and aesthetics to life in an on-brand way across various interactive touchpoints.
- Visual and Motion Design Reference - Work with creative teams during conception and pre-production phases to communicate to clients the role that digital content will have in a physical installation.
- Content Team Collaboration - Work with internal and external animators, programmers and 3D artists to bring a vision to life. Experience working in real-time workflows is a bonus.
- Asset Production - Follow design systems and champion best practices to produce production-ready designs.
Experience Needed / Our Requirements
- Currently pursuing or recently completed a Bachelor's or Master's degree in Design or 3D Animation.
- Good motion design skills (2D and/or 3D) in a wide range of styles.
- Creative thinker and problem solver.
- Can take a concept and interpret it into motion design that meets clients’ goals and aligns with campaign strategy.
- Ability to express your creative ideas through mockups, mood boards, style frames, and motion prototypes.
- Prototype and express design/motion approach across 2D/3D animation, interaction design, and visual effects.
- Prior experience of working in interdisciplinary teams for the creation of engaging and interactive digital storytelling.
- Familiarity or proficiency with Adobe Suite (Illustrator, Photoshop, After Effects), Blender, or similar software.
- You have a personal interest in new technologies, software, and experimental design.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team in a fast-paced environment.
- Prior internship or work experience in a similar role would be an advantage.
